The Hunter Engineering R811 alignment system combines cutting edge equipment and software to maximize precision and accuracy for customers' car re-alignment. Four permanently mounted, high-resolution digital video cameras constantly monitor the technician's progress toward properly aligning the vehicle by scanning the wheel-mounted alignment target on each wheel.

This information is displayed in real-time on a computer monitor, providing the technician with the information needed to quickly and accurately adjust the wheels' alignment. WinAlign, the software component, complements the system with an extensive database of alignment specification information for various makes and models of new and used cars. The technician is also supplied with extensive training and technical support data to further improve accuracy. And because there is no calibration or electronics, no cables and no batteries, the technician can complete the process more quickly.

Proper car alignment offers several benefits to customers, including better safety and handling of the vehicle, extending the life of the tires and maintaining optimal gas mileage.
